What skills do mechanical engineering training programs typically teach?

Mechanical engineering training programs in Canada are designed to equip students with a comprehensive set of skills essential for success in the field. These programs typically cover fundamental engineering principles, including thermodynamics, fluid mechanics, and materials science. Students also learn advanced mathematical concepts, such as calculus and differential equations, which are crucial for complex problem-solving in engineering.

In addition to theoretical knowledge, training programs emphasize practical skills through hands-on laboratory work and design projects. Students gain proficiency in computer-aided design (CAD) software, 3D modeling, and simulation tools widely used in the industry. Many programs also incorporate courses on manufacturing processes, robotics, and automation to prepare graduates for the evolving demands of modern engineering workplaces.

Which industries hire mechanical engineers without prior experience in Canada?

Several industries in Canada are open to hiring mechanical engineers fresh out of training programs. The manufacturing sector, including automotive and aerospace industries, often provides entry-level positions for new graduates. These roles may involve product design, quality control, or process improvement.

The energy sector, encompassing oil and gas, renewable energy, and power generation, also offers opportunities for inexperienced mechanical engineers. Entry-level positions in this field might focus on equipment maintenance, energy efficiency improvements, or system design.

Construction and infrastructure industries frequently hire new mechanical engineers for roles in HVAC system design, building services, and project management. Additionally, consulting firms specializing in engineering services often recruit fresh talent to work on diverse projects across multiple industries.

How can you start your mechanical engineering career through training in Canada?

To begin a mechanical engineering career in Canada through training, the first step is to enroll in an accredited engineering program at a recognized Canadian university or college. These programs typically last four years for a bachelor’s degree, which is the minimum educational requirement for most entry-level positions.

During your studies, it’s crucial to participate in co-op programs or internships, which many Canadian institutions offer. These experiences provide valuable hands-on training and can often lead to full-time employment opportunities after graduation.

After completing your degree, you’ll need to gain professional experience under the supervision of a licensed engineer. This is part of the process to become a Professional Engineer (P.Eng.), which is a highly regarded designation in Canada and often required for career advancement.

What are the key factors to consider when choosing a mechanical engineering program?

When selecting a mechanical engineering program in Canada, consider the institution’s accreditation status. Programs accredited by Engineers Canada ensure that graduates meet the academic requirements for professional engineering licensure.

Look for programs that offer a balance between theoretical knowledge and practical application. Universities with strong industry connections and well-equipped laboratories can provide more opportunities for hands-on learning and potential job placements.

Consider the specialization options available within the program. Some institutions offer focuses in areas like aerospace, robotics, or sustainable energy, which can align with your career goals and interests in the mechanical engineering field.

What are the career prospects for mechanical engineers in Canada?

The career outlook for mechanical engineers in Canada is generally positive. According to the Canadian Occupational Projection System, the demand for mechanical engineers is expected to remain stable, with a balanced labor market projected through 2028.

Mechanical engineers in Canada can expect competitive salaries, with entry-level positions typically starting around CAD 50,000 to 60,000 per year. With experience and professional certification, salaries can increase significantly, often reaching over CAD 100,000 for senior positions.

Career advancement opportunities are plentiful, with possibilities to move into management roles, specialized technical positions, or even entrepreneurship by starting engineering consulting firms.

What are the costs associated with mechanical engineering training in Canada?

The cost of mechanical engineering training in Canada varies depending on the institution and program type. Here’s a comparison of typical costs for domestic students at different types of institutions:


Institution Type Average Annual Tuition Program Duration Additional Costs
Public University CAD 7,000 - 12,000 4 years Books, supplies: ~CAD 1,000/year
Private University CAD 20,000 - 30,000 4 years Books, supplies: ~CAD 1,200/year
Technical College CAD 5,000 - 8,000 2-3 years Tools, equipment: ~CAD 1,500/year

Prices, rates, or cost estimates mentioned in this article are based on the latest available information but may change over time. Independent research is advised before making financial decisions.

It’s important to note that international students typically pay higher tuition fees, often two to three times the amount for domestic students. Additionally, living expenses, which can range from CAD 10,000 to 20,000 per year depending on the location, should be factored into the overall cost of pursuing mechanical engineering training in Canada.
